First up, Simply Orange. Known for its sleek packaging and straightforward approach, Simply Orange boasts a "close-to-the-fruit" experience. Their process emphasizes minimizing processing, aiming for a taste that’s as close to squeezing an orange yourself as possible. They offer a variety of options, including pulp-free, some pulp, and high pulp, catering to different preferences. One of their key selling points is the "Simply" aspect – no artificial flavors or preservatives.

Now, let's turn our attention to Florida's Natural. This brand proudly wears its Floridian heritage on its sleeve. They emphasize that their oranges are grown by Florida citrus growers, creating a sense of local authenticity. This connection to Florida, and its association with sunny citrus groves, is a major part of their appeal. Like Simply Orange, they also offer different pulp levels to suit your liking. Florida's Natural often highlights the freshness and quality that comes from using exclusively Florida-grown oranges.
So, what are the key differences? While both strive for a fresh, natural taste, their approaches vary slightly. Some argue that Simply Orange has a slightly sweeter, more consistent flavor profile, possibly due to their blending process. Florida's Natural, on the other hand, might have more variability in taste depending on the season and the specific orange crops used. This can lead to a more nuanced, complex flavor that some prefer.
